The giant Philippine frog, large swamp frog, or Mindanao fanged frog is a species of frog in the family Dicroglossidae. It is endemic to the Philippines. Its natural habitats are tropical moist lowland forests, subtropical or tropical moist montane forests, rivers, intermittent rivers, freshwater marshes, and intermittent freshwater marshes.Philippine Spiny Cinnamon Frog (Nyctixalus Spinosus. Endemic to the Philippines and is native to Mindanao, Leyte, Bohol and Basilan Islands, with an altitudinal range of 500-1,100 m above sea level. It probably occurs more widely than current records suggest, especially in areas between known sites. How big is a Philippine frog? The giant fanged frog species is 8 in (20.3 cm) in length and has a distinct, deep call. (2001 [2002]) Application of lineage-based species concepts to oceanic island frog populations: the effects of differing taxonomic philosophies on the estimation of Philippine biodiversity.Tinolang palaka cooking steps. Heat oil in a deep pot and saute onions, garlic, and ginger until softened and aromatic. Add fish and cook for about a minute or two. Add water and bring to a boil. Add frog legs. Lower heat, cover, and cook for 8 to 10 minutes or until tender.
